First off, nylon is a super popular material in the manufacturing world. It's got a whole bunch of great qualities that make it suitable for all sorts of applications, especially when it comes to sealing. Nylon is known for its high strength, good abrasion resistance, and excellent chemical resistance. These features play a big role in how well nylon parts can seal.

Let's start with the strength aspect. Nylon parts can withstand a fair amount of pressure without deforming. This is crucial for sealing applications because if a part gets squished or warped under pressure, it won't be able to create a proper seal. For example, in hydraulic systems where there's high pressure fluid flowing around, nylon parts can hold up and maintain their shape, ensuring a tight seal. This strength also means that nylon parts can last a long time, reducing the need for frequent replacements.

Another important factor is abrasion resistance. In many sealing applications, the parts are constantly rubbing against other surfaces. If the material isn't abrasion - resistant, it'll wear down quickly, and the seal will be compromised. Nylon's ability to resist abrasion helps it keep its integrity over time. Whether it's in a mechanical device where there's a lot of moving parts or in a pipeline where there might be some particulate matter in the fluid, nylon parts can handle the wear and tear and still maintain a good seal.

Chemical resistance is also a game - changer. Nylon can resist a wide range of chemicals, including oils, solvents, and some acids. This is vital in industries where the parts come into contact with different substances. For instance, in the automotive industry, nylon parts are used in fuel systems. They need to be able to withstand the corrosive effects of gasoline and other fuels. Thanks to its chemical resistance, nylon can form a reliable seal in these harsh environments, preventing leaks and ensuring the proper functioning of the system.

Now, let's talk about some specific types of nylon parts and their sealing properties.

Nylon Sheets

Nylon Sheets are often used in sealing applications where a flat, flexible surface is needed. They can be cut into custom shapes to fit different sealing requirements. Nylon sheets have a smooth surface, which helps in creating a good contact with the mating surfaces. This smoothness reduces the chances of leaks by eliminating gaps that could allow fluids or gases to pass through. They can also be easily bonded or welded to other parts, further enhancing the sealing performance. For example, in some industrial machinery, nylon sheets are used as gaskets to seal the joints between different components. The flexibility of the sheets allows them to conform to the shape of the surfaces, providing a tight and reliable seal.

Nylon PA12 Tube

Nylon PA12 Tube is another great example of a nylon part with excellent sealing properties. These tubes are often used in fluid transfer applications. They have a uniform wall thickness, which helps in maintaining a consistent seal along the length of the tube. The smooth inner surface of the tube reduces friction, allowing the fluid to flow smoothly while also preventing any build - up that could damage the seal. Nylon PA12 tubes are also flexible, which makes them easy to install in different configurations. In medical devices, for example, these tubes are used to transfer fluids, and their sealing properties ensure that there are no leaks, which is crucial for patient safety.

But it's not all sunshine and rainbows. There are some limitations to the sealing properties of nylon parts. For one, nylon can absorb moisture. When it absorbs moisture, it can swell, which might affect the sealing performance. In applications where there's a high humidity environment or where the parts are constantly exposed to water, special precautions need to be taken. This could include using a moisture - resistant coating or choosing a different type of nylon that has lower moisture absorption.

Also, at very high temperatures, nylon can start to lose its strength and dimensional stability. In applications where there are extreme temperature variations, the sealing performance might be affected. However, there are high - temperature - resistant grades of nylon available that can handle these conditions better.
